21 Churches. 2 Priests. 167 Objections. This Is Happening Now! 05.05.2026

The Church of England is proposing to put 21 churches under 2 priests in one deanery in Cornwall. 167 people have formally objected. A hearing is being held this month to decide whether it goes ahead anyway. This is not a hypothetical. This is Kerrier deanery in the Diocese of Truro. The Church Is Spending £100 Million And It Isn't On You! 17.04.2026

The Church Commissioners have committed £100 million to Project Spire, a reparations fund for historic links to the slave trade. But the history it rests on is being challenged by serious scholars. The legal basis is uncertain. And 81% of Anglicans say this is not what they want their Church to spend money on. Meanwhile parishes are closing. Vicarages sit empty. Clergy are burning out. The Gen Z Revival That Wasn’t — And What Faithfulness Looks Like Now! 28.03.2026

The report that claimed Gen Z was returning to church has now been withdrawn. After months of headlines suggesting a “quiet revival,” the Bible Society’s report The Quiet Revival has been pulled following concerns about data reliability and survey methodology.
